Topics Covered
- 1. Introduction to State Machines: Learners will study the fundamental concepts of state machines and their application in software development. They will gain foundational skills in identifying and modeling state transitions.
- 2. State Machine Design Principles: This module covers best practices for designing state machines, including criteria for state decomposition and composition. Learners will develop the ability to create efficient and maintainable state machine designs.
- 3. Debugging Basics for State Machines: Learners will learn basic debugging techniques for state machines, including how to set breakpoints, inspect state transitions, and trace execution paths. Practical skills in identifying common issues will be developed.
- 4. Advanced Debugging Techniques: This module delves into more sophisticated debugging strategies for complex state paths, such as using log analysis, state transition diagrams, and automated testing tools. Advanced skills in diagnosing and resolving complex issues will be enhanced.
- 5. State Machine Optimization: Learners will explore methods for optimizing state machine performance, including minimizing state transitions and reducing memory usage. Practical skills in refining state machine efficiency will be developed.
- 6. Debugging State Machine Interactions: This module focuses on debugging interactions between multiple state machines, including identifying and resolving conflicts. Skills in analyzing and managing complex system interactions will be strengthened.
- 7. Real-World Debugging Case Studies: Through case studies, learners will apply their knowledge to real-world debugging scenarios involving complex state paths. They will gain experience in tackling practical challenges and implementing effective solutions.
- 8. Advanced Topics in State Machine Debugging: This module covers advanced topics such as debugging concurrent state machines, dealing with error states, and integrating state machines with other software components. Learners will develop expertise in handling complex, multi-faceted debugging tasks.
- 9. Debugging Tools and Frameworks: Learners will learn to use various debugging tools and frameworks specifically designed for state machine debugging. Practical skills in leveraging these resources to enhance debugging efficiency will be developed.
- 10. Continuous Integration and Continuous Deployment (CI/CD): This module covers integrating state machine debugging into CI/CD pipelines, ensuring that debugging processes are automated and streamlined. Learners will learn how to maintain high-quality state machine development workflows.
